]> git.ipfire.org Git - thirdparty/squid.git/commitdiff
Bugzilla #255: Core dump in sslStart if miss_access is denied
authorhno <>
Fri, 26 Oct 2001 01:51:27 +0000 (01:51 +0000)
committerhno <>
Fri, 26 Oct 2001 01:51:27 +0000 (01:51 +0000)
src/ssl.cc
src/tunnel.cc

index 4a347f3072f84b68d9b79b0b66069fbed9d3ff5d..c89973f998574a4534dce73c1bd7ed6221710993 100644 (file)
@@ -1,6 +1,6 @@
 
 /*
- * $Id: ssl.cc,v 1.116 2001/10/24 08:19:08 hno Exp $
+ * $Id: ssl.cc,v 1.117 2001/10/25 19:51:27 hno Exp $
  *
  * DEBUG: section 26    Secure Sockets Layer Proxy
  * AUTHOR: Duane Wessels
@@ -456,7 +456,6 @@ sslStart(int fd, const char *url, request_t * request, size_t * size_ptr, int *s
        answer = aclCheckFast(Config.accessList.miss, &ch);
        if (answer == 0) {
            err = errorCon(ERR_FORWARDING_DENIED, HTTP_FORBIDDEN);
-           *sslState->status_ptr = HTTP_FORBIDDEN;
            err->request = requestLink(request);
            err->src_addr = request->client_addr;
            errorSend(fd, err);
index 847b1240f63b195d8b671b3db18dae80f331e74f..16004b28c7bd536da899fce8c1095b1298f7453a 100644 (file)
@@ -1,6 +1,6 @@
 
 /*
- * $Id: tunnel.cc,v 1.116 2001/10/24 08:19:08 hno Exp $
+ * $Id: tunnel.cc,v 1.117 2001/10/25 19:51:27 hno Exp $
  *
  * DEBUG: section 26    Secure Sockets Layer Proxy
  * AUTHOR: Duane Wessels
@@ -456,7 +456,6 @@ sslStart(int fd, const char *url, request_t * request, size_t * size_ptr, int *s
        answer = aclCheckFast(Config.accessList.miss, &ch);
        if (answer == 0) {
            err = errorCon(ERR_FORWARDING_DENIED, HTTP_FORBIDDEN);
-           *sslState->status_ptr = HTTP_FORBIDDEN;
            err->request = requestLink(request);
            err->src_addr = request->client_addr;
            errorSend(fd, err);